Output d1b17eb24f8c67b077a6d52f54f85e2dc829ea7f11d2856a05abfa932ecde03b:0

value
975000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2980e687557a2cdc635fbf87dba3162d06d42a1 OP_EQUAL
address
3LtXytDL6D7rTCptNSKCSSFmXeinaEFDey
transaction
d1b17eb24f8c67b077a6d52f54f85e2dc829ea7f11d2856a05abfa932ecde03b
confirmations
143840
spent
true